1. A manufactured home is being installed in a state where HUD administers the federal
installation program. Which regulatory part primarily establishes the HUD Manufactured
Home Installation Program requirements?

,A. 24 CFR Part 3280
B. 24 CFR Part 3282
C. 24 CFR Part 3286
D. 24 CFR Part 3288

Rationale: Part 3286 establishes the Manufactured Home Installation Program, including
requirements related to installer licensing, training, inspections, and certification in HUD-
administered states. Part 3285 establishes the Model Manufactured Home Installation
Standards.

2. Before beginning an installation, an installer receives the manufacturer's installation
manual for the specific home. What is the most appropriate use of those instructions?

A. Use them only if the local building department has no requirements
B. Follow the approved manufacturer installation designs and instructions applicable to the
home and site
C. Replace them with the installer's preferred foundation method
D. Use them only for utility connections

Rationale: Manufacturer installation instructions are a central part of the installation process
and must be followed unless an approved alternative design is properly developed and
authorized. They provide home-specific requirements that generic installation practices may not
address.

3. What is the primary purpose of properly preparing the manufactured home site before
installation?

A. To reduce the manufacturer's transportation costs
B. To make the home easier to repaint
C. To eliminate the need for anchoring
D. To provide stable support and control drainage and site-related hazards

Rationale: Site preparation establishes suitable conditions for the foundation and support
system and helps prevent problems caused by unstable soil, standing water, erosion, or improper
drainage. It is a fundamental part of a successful installation.

4. During the site inspection, an installer observes that surface water naturally flows
toward the proposed foundation area. What should receive priority?

A. Begin setting the home and correct drainage later
B. Increase the number of interior piers
C. Correct or control the drainage condition before proceeding with the installation
D. Install the perimeter skirting first

, Rationale: Water directed toward the foundation can undermine support, contribute to
settlement, and create long-term moisture problems. Drainage should be addressed as part of
site preparation rather than treated as an afterthought.

5. Which organization approves manufactured home installation designs and instructions
for use with manufactured homes?

A. The local fire marshal
B. The transport company
C. The homeowner
D. The Design Approval Primary Inspection Agency (DAPIA)

Rationale: DAPIA approval is part of HUD's manufactured housing regulatory framework.
Manufacturer installation designs and instructions are reviewed through the DAPIA process
before being supplied for use.

6. A manufacturer’s installation instructions do not address an unusual site condition, such
as a condition requiring a different support or anchorage design. What is the appropriate
approach?

A. Make an undocumented field modification
B. Use a neighboring home's foundation design
C. Obtain an appropriate approved alternate design rather than improvising the installation
D. Ignore the unusual condition if the home appears level

Rationale: Unusual site conditions can require engineered or otherwise approved alternatives.
An installer should not independently create a structural support or anchorage system without
the approvals required by the applicable regulations.

7. Why is maintaining the specified relationship between a diagonal tie-down strap and the
ground important?

A. It determines the home's interior ceiling height
B. It controls the home's electrical load
C. It eliminates the need for ground anchors
D. It affects the performance and geometry of the anchorage system

Rationale: The angle and dimensional placement of diagonal tie-downs affect how forces are
transferred from the home to the anchorage system. Improper geometry can reduce the
effectiveness of the system even when the components themselves are adequate.
